This Is Why Lots Of Scottish People Hate Donald Trump

https://www.buzzfeed.com/hilarywardle/this-is-why-lots-of-scottish-people-hate-trump

So, you may have noticed that whenever Donald Trump visits Scotland, he gets a bit of a negative reception.

People rubbing balloons on his hair, calling him a cunt and a bawbag, mercilessly trolling him on Twitter. That sort of thing. It's been going on for years, way before he became president. So, what's up?

It started in 2006 when Trump decided to buy an estate in Aberdeenshire and turn it into a golf resort. But there were some sand dunes standing in his way.
